Home
last modified time | relevance | path

Searched refs:uniphier_i2c_priv (Results 1 – 1 of 1) sorted by relevance

/external/u-boot/drivers/i2c/
Di2c-uniphier.c40 struct uniphier_i2c_priv { struct
50 struct uniphier_i2c_priv *priv = dev_get_priv(dev); in uniphier_i2c_probe() argument
70 static int send_and_recv_byte(struct uniphier_i2c_priv *priv, u32 dtrm) in send_and_recv_byte()
85 static int send_byte(struct uniphier_i2c_priv *priv, u32 dtrm, bool *stop) in send_byte()
104 static int uniphier_i2c_transmit(struct uniphier_i2c_priv *priv, uint addr, in uniphier_i2c_transmit()
128 static int uniphier_i2c_receive(struct uniphier_i2c_priv *priv, uint addr, in uniphier_i2c_receive()
154 struct uniphier_i2c_priv *priv = dev_get_priv(bus); in uniphier_i2c_xfer()
177 struct uniphier_i2c_priv *priv = dev_get_priv(bus); in uniphier_i2c_set_bus_speed()
216 .priv_auto_alloc_size = sizeof(struct uniphier_i2c_priv),